Zucchini Pancakes
These zucchini pancakes are a fantastic way to incorporate more vegetables into your diet while enjoying a satisfying meal. Their crispy exterior and moist interior will leave you craving more!
Ingredients:
- 2 medium zucchinis, grated
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 cup all-purpose flour (can substitute with whole wheat flour or gluten-free flour)
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 large egg
- 2 green onions, finely chopped
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- Olive oil or cooking spray for frying
Instructions:
- Start by grating the zucchinis using a box grater. Place the grated zucchini in a clean kitchen towel and squeeze out excess moisture. This step is crucial to avoid soggy pancakes.
- In a large bowl, combine the grated zucchini with salt. Let it sit for about 10 minutes, which will help to draw out more moisture.
- After 10 minutes, add the flour, Parmesan cheese, egg, green onions, minced garlic, black pepper, and baking powder to the bowl with the zucchini. Mix well until all ingredients are incorporated, forming a batter.
- Preheat a large skillet over medium heat and add a tablespoon of olive oil or use cooking spray for a lighter option.
- Once the oil is hot, spoon about 1/4 cup of the batter onto the skillet for each pancake. Flatten gently with the back of the spoon. Cook for about 3-4 minutes on one side, until golden brown, then flip and cook for another 3-4 minutes on the other side.
- Transfer the cooked pancakes to a plate and keep them warm in a low oven while you repeat with the remaining batter.
- Serve the zucchini pancakes warm with your favorite toppings, such as sour cream, yogurt, or a sprinkle of fresh herbs.
